The thread about Mack Hollins got me to look at his stats relative to the other WRs, as I posted in that thread.
Then I got interested in how our overall passing offense performs so I looked at receiving stats for everybody including TEs and RBs. Thought it would be good to share and discuss, especially because sentiment about players on this board is not always rooted in accurate perception of their performance.
Here’s what I found, between ESPN and StatMuse. ESPN didn’t have passing target counts for RBs so I found that data on statmuse.com.

Player | Catches | Targets | Percentage |
| Terrell Jennings | 1 | 1 | 100 |
| Austin Hooper | 13 | 14 | 92.85714286 |
| Mack Hollins | 20 | 23 | 86.95652174 |
| Stefan Diggs | 45 | 53 | 84.90566038 |
| Rhamondre Stevenson | 16 | 19 | 84.21052632 |
| Treyveon Henderson | 20 | 24 | 83.33333333 |
| Kayshon Boutte | 23 | 31 | 74.19354839 |
| Hunter Henry | 29 | 43 | 67.44186047 |
| Pop Douglas | 18 | 30 | 60 |
| Kyle Williams | 2 | 6 | 33.33333333 |
